Title: Shi Chen: Innovator in Tool Holder Technologies
Introduction
Shi Chen, based in Huntingdon, PA, is a remarkable inventor with a prolific portfolio of 21 patents. His inventions primarily focus on advancements in tool holder technologies, aiming to improve efficiency and precision in machining processes.
Latest Patents
Among his latest contributions are two notable patents. The first is a "Clamp for Tool Holder," which introduces an innovative design that features a body with an insert-receiving pocket and threaded clamp-receiving bore. This clamp allows for pressurized coolant from a coolant source to flow effectively, ensuring optimal cooling at the cutting insert-workpiece interface. The second patent, titled "Method and Apparatus for Center Height Alignment of a Boring Bar," includes a seat member equipped with a digital angle gauge. This apparatus simplifies the process of aligning the center height of a boring bar, enhancing accuracy in machining applications.
